The logging buffered Global Configuration mode command limits syslog
messages displayed from an internal buffer based on severity. Use the no form of
this command to cancel using the buffer.
Syntax
level
logging buffered
no logging buffered
Parameters
level
— Specifies the severity level of messages logged in the buffer. The
possible values are: emergencies, alerts, critical, errors, warnings,
notifications, informational, debugging.
